This pattern is knitted with a set of double-pointed needles, and you should have some experience and practice with cable needles. The cable runs across the entire back of the hand, and the wrist warmers fit adults.
This design now features a thumb gusset, so the wrist warmers stay right where they’re supposed to. Maybe you’re still looking for an idea for a quick little Christmas gift for her or him—in a color that works for both.
